We are seeking a Senior Android Engineer to join our team to be a driving force behind our clients publicly facing Android application. You will be responsible for the end-to-end development of new features, from technical design to implementation and release. We are seeking a seasoned professional with a history of building and scaling successful Android products.
Must-Have Experience & Skills:
* Extensive commercial experience developing, releasing, and maintaining native Android applications using Kotlin and Java.
* A demonstrated track record of shipping high-quality, public-facing products in previous roles.
* Deep experience integrating with RESTful APIs in a production environment.
* A strong commitment to quality, evidenced by comprehensive unit and automated testing.
* Proficiency with CI/CD pipelines and expert-level use of Git.
* Proven ability to thrive in an Agile, cross-functional team environment.
Highly Desirable Skills & Experience:
* Commercial experience with Jetpack Compose.
* Experience architecting applications with a large, active user base.
* Familiarity with GitLab CI/CD.
* Cloud experience with AWS.
* A passion for mentoring and uplifting team-wide engineering practices.